WebCampgrounds within 100km of CUDGEGONG, NSW 29 Campsites with detailed information. 8 National Park, Dam, Conservation Area or State Forests. 125 Campsites … WebCudgegong River Park in Mudgee, New South Wales Australia Caravan Parks New South Wales Mudgee Cudgegong River Park Contact Cudgegong River Park for price … WebFeb 8, 2014 · The Cudgegong now runs between two dams, Windamere & Burrendong. Windamere was built as a back up for Burrendong & the water released from it keeps the river at a fairly constant level barring heavy rains. Burrendong feeds the cotton farmers out west.
